Abstract : In the present employment market, campus placement holds a great experience and
gift for students as well as educational institutes. While, it helps to the student community in
building a strong foundation for the professional career ahead without facing the real-world
job struggle, peer-competition or family pressure, a good placement record gives a
competitive edge to an institution / University in their educational market. Campus
placements provide the students with a foot-in- the-door opportunity, enabling them to start
off their career right after they have completed their course curriculum. Furthermore, they
get to interact and engage with the industry professionals during the placement drives, which
further help lay a foundation for their prospective career in the future as they familiarize with
potential contacts from their chosen career field. Placements have gradually become an
integral part of an institute’s offerings, which was not the scenario earlier. Nowadays,
students pay special attention to placement records while selecting a college or university for
the admission. And it is rightly so, if a student is paying huge amount of parents’ hard-earned
money as fees to the institutes/Universities, he/she has the right to calculate the ROI (return
on investment), which in this case is a lucrative job. This research paper clearly identifies
various influencing factors of Covid19 on employment market, employment opportunities of
young graduates during pandemic period and impact of Covid19 on employment market for
fresher during first wave period of Covid19 in the study area.
